Insurance Brokers: Jonathan Balkind – Fox-pitt, Kelton Inc

JONATHAN B. BALKIND is a Senior Vice President and head of insurance brokerage and bank research at Fox-Pitt, Kelton Inc. (FPK). Mr. Balkind joined FPK in 1996 as a regional bank and insurance analyst. On the banking side, Mr. Balkind has coverage responsibility for predominantly large and mid-cap banks. In the insurance area, Mr. Balkind has coverage responsibility for the brokerage industry, which consists of five companies ranging in market cap from $1 billion to $30 billion. Prior to joining FPK, Mr. Balkind spent four years as a corporate insurance broker at Marsh & McLennan Companies in New York, where he primarily represented Fortune 1000 companies. He holds an MBA degree from New York University's Stern School of Business and a BA degree in Economics from St. Lawrence University. Profile
